All of these beliefs and associations with the raven made it a popular symbol in Viking culture, and it continues to be an enduring symbol in modern times.. Symbolism and Meanings of Viking Raven Tattoos. Viking raven tattoos are rich in symbolism and meanings that have been passed down through centuries of Norse mythology and folklore. In Viking culture, ravens were considered to be sacred.

Thor's Hammer Tattoos have become increasingly popular in recent years, and for a good reason. This tattoo carries with it a powerful meaning that is deeply rooted in Norse mythology. Mjölnir, the legendary weapon of Thor, represents strength, power, and protection. The symbolism behind this tattoo goes beyond just the image of a hammer.

Viking Tattoo Symbolism Norse Mythology Viking tattoos are deeply rooted in Norse mythology, which is full of gods, heroes, and mythical creatures. Some popular Norse mythology-inspired designs include: Odin: The chief of the gods, often depicted as a one-eyed warrior, symbolizing wisdom and knowledge.

1. Traditional Viking Tattoo Body art was a way to establish a social hierarchy, a means of expression and personal identification, and also had the ability to instill fear in others. Many people are drawn to Traditional Viking tattoos to honor the notorious raiders and warriors of the Medieval world.
